In today's world, where environmental concerns are at the forefront of public discourse, the importance of monitoring emissions from various sources cannot be overstated. One essential tool in this endeavor is the flue gas analyser, a device designed to measure the composition of gases emitted from industrial processes, heating systems, and power plants. The flue gas analyser plays a crucial role in ensuring compliance with environmental regulations and improving energy efficiency.A flue gas analyser typically measures several key parameters, including carbon dioxide (CO2), carbon monoxide (CO), oxygen (O2), nitrogen oxides (NOx), and particulate matter. By analyzing these components, operators can gain valuable insights into the combustion process and identify areas for improvement. For instance, an excess of carbon monoxide may indicate incomplete combustion, which not only wastes fuel but also poses safety risks. By adjusting the combustion process based on the data provided by the flue gas analyser, facilities can optimize their operations and reduce harmful emissions.Moreover, the use of a flue gas analyser is vital for maintaining energy efficiency in heating systems. In residential and commercial buildings, furnaces and boilers must operate within specific parameters to ensure optimal performance. Regular testing with a flue gas analyser allows technicians to verify that these systems are functioning correctly and efficiently. If a system is found to be emitting excessive levels of pollutants, it may be necessary to perform maintenance or upgrades to restore its efficiency.Another significant benefit of using a flue gas analyser is its contribution to air quality management.
